醃 (yān) - To preserve food by salting, pickling, or curing & to marinate.
醃 · yān
To preserve food by salting, pickling, or curing;
to marinate.

Usage & contexts
Examples
- Grandma pickles vegetables every winter (醃菜).
- This is salted fish (醃魚).
- They cure meat for the winter (醃肉).
- I like pickled mustard greens (醃酸菜).
Collocations
- Pickled vegetables(醃菜)
- Salted fish(醃魚)
- Cured meat(醃肉)
- Pickled mustard greens(醃酸菜)
- Pickled radish(醃蘿蔔)
- Pickling method(醃制法)
